At the end of April, the capital of Slovakia came alive again with fashion! The starting third decade of the BRATISLAVA FASHION DAYS (BMD) project was a visual experience for the audience, to whom the designers showed the best from the SPRING/SUMMER season. Over the course of two days, BMD organizer Mária Reháková brought to the guests the creations of stalwarts of Slovak fashion design and young creative authors.
